The two volumes of the periodical consist of "Volume XXXVI, Part I -November, 1908, to April, 1909", and "Volume XXXVI, Part II - May to October, 1909".
Here, appearing for the first time, are the first 14 occupations, represented in rhymes and illustrated by Denslow, which were subsequently reproduced in the book of the same title published in 1909.
The fourteen occupations consist of: "The Autoist", "The Pirate", "The Clown", "The Knight", "The Cowboy", "The Actor", "The Fireman", "The Hunter", "The Orator", "The Drum-Major", "The Soldier", "The Policeman", "The Baseball Player", and "The Sailor".
In the bibliography included in "W.W. Denslow" by Douglas G. Greene and Michael Patrick Hearn the authors describe the book, "Illustrated in color and black and white by Denslow. The book contains poems and pictures which first appeared in St. Nicholas magazine, November, 1908, through October, 1909, with ten additional episodes which had not previously been published." [Greene & Hearn 44]. Very good .
